How Should You Prepare Tap Water for Betta Fish?

To prepare tap water for Betta fish, start by dechlorinating the water and adjusting its temperature. Betta fish thrive in temperatures between 76°F and 82°F, which is approximately 24°C to 28°C. Most common tap water contains chlorine and chloramines, which can harm fish. Therefore, using a water conditioner is essential to remove these harmful chemicals.

Use a water conditioner that effectively neutralizes chlorine and chloramines in a dose per gallon as specified on the product label. For example, if your tap water contains 1 ppm of chlorine and you have 10 gallons of water, a suitable conditioner may require an application of 10 drops, but confirmation on the product is advisable.

Additionally, test the pH level of the water. Betta fish prefer a pH range of 6.5 to 7.5. Most tap water has a pH around 7.0, which is suitable. However, variations can occur depending on the source and treatment of the municipal water supply. If the pH is too high or too low, you can use pH adjusters designed for aquarium use.

There are external factors that can affect tap water suitability. Seasonal changes can alter water chemistry. In warmer months, increased levels of nitrogen compounds may occur due to agricultural runoff, affecting the water quality. Always monitor water parameters regularly to ensure a stable environment for your Betta fish.

In summary, prepare tap water for Betta fish by dechlorinating it, ensuring proper temperature, and testing pH levels. Regular monitoring of these factors will contribute to a healthy habitat for your fish. How Often Should You Replace the Water for Betta Fish?

You should replace the water for Betta fish once a week. This frequency helps maintain water quality. Clean water is essential for the health of Betta fish. They thrive in stable and filtered environments. During the water change, replace about 25% to 50% of the water. This amount is sufficient to eliminate harmful waste while preserving beneficial bacteria. Always use a water conditioner to remove chlorine and heavy metals from tap water. Monitor the water temperature and pH levels to ensure they remain suitable for your Betta. Regular water changes support the fish’s overall well-being and prevent stress, ensuring a healthy environment.

  1. Maintain Clean Water Through Regular Filtration: Keeping Betta fish habitat clean is essential. Effective filtration reduces harmful waste and toxins. A quality filter will help eliminate ammonia, nitrates, and nitrites, which can harm fish health. According to the American Veterinary Medical Association, proper filtration is a cornerstone of maintaining aquatic systems.

  2. Monitor and Adjust Water Temperature: Betta fish thrive in warm water between 76°F to 82°F (24°C to 28°C). Sudden temperature fluctuations can stress the fish and lead to illness. Using a reliable aquarium heater ensures temperature stability. The Betta fish is a tropical species, and any temperature drop can adversely affect its immune system.

  3. Check and Balance Water pH Levels: The optimal pH range for Betta fish is between 6.5 and 7.5. A pH below or above this range can lead to stress and health issues. Test kits are available to measure pH levels. The Environmental Protection Agency recommends regular pH testing to ensure water quality remains within acceptable parameters.

  4. Conduct Regular Water Changes: Regularly changing 20% to 50% of the water weekly prevents the buildup of harmful substances. Doing so helps maintain water clarity and oxygen levels. Many aquarists recommend this practice to reduce waste accumulation and boost fish well-being.

  5. Avoid Chlorine and Harmful Chemicals: Tap water often contains chlorine, which is toxic to fish. Use a water conditioner to dechlorinate the water before adding it to the aquarium. The University of Florida advises using dechlorinators to create a safe environment for aquatic life.

  6. Use Aquarium Salt When Necessary: Adding aquarium salt can help treat illnesses and reduce stress but should be used sparingly. It is effective for gill and fin health but can harm plants. Consult aquatic specialists for guidance on appropriate usage.

  7. Observe Fish Behavior for Health Indicators: Regularly monitoring Betta fish behavior can provide insights into water conditions. Gasping at the surface or lethargy may indicate poor water quality. Keeping a log of fish behaviors can help detect issues early.

  8. Choose Appropriate Tank Mates: Not all fish are compatible with Betta fish, as Bettas can be territorial. Selecting non-aggressive companions reduces stress. Researching compatible Betta tank mates is essential for a peaceful aquarium environment.
